New Energy Farms (NEF) and Explante Biotecnologia are supplying synthetic seeds (CEEDS™) to the Brazilian sugarcane market through direct sales and in-house production by the mills (licensing).

 

After seven years of development and the first tests with CEEDS™ carried out in several mills in Brazil, the technology has been improved, offering benefits in terms of disease-free material that can be planted mechanically to reduce production costs and use 100% of nursery areas for the production of sugar, ethanol and energy.

CEEDS™ is a technology patented by NEF, consisting of small capsules of approximately 07 cm, containing substrate, nutrients, crop protection, biologicals and vigorous plant material. They are coated with a totally biodegradable polymer to protect them during storage and planting (images below). Planting is done with fully automatic planters, eliminating the need for labour in the field, increasing planting speed and revolutionising the way sugar cane is planted. CEEDS™ can be used to produce planting material for any variety available in Brazil.

 

Explante is now making CEEDS™ sugarcane available for purchase by Brazilian customers in a first project to enable customers to plant demonstration areas. This programme will also offer partner mills the opportunity to get to know all aspects of the in-house production option for mills that use CEEDS™ production modules for in-house supply (which can be from 500 to 5,000 ha per year per production module). These modules are horticulture-intensive sites of reduced size, which can be a new project or an expansion of the production capacity of existing facilities for the production of seedlings (MPB). CEEDS™ has been successfully used to produce material from all Brazilian breeding programmes and can be used by clients for the varieties they want. New Energy Farms (NEF) is an agricultural technology company created in 2010 to develop synthetic seeds for crops that do not produce conventional seeds, such as sugar cane. NEF has developed and patented the unique and innovative CEEDS™ technology for the multiplication and planting of sugarcane crops worldwide. CEEDS™ is a small coated propagule that is planted directly in the field like a conventional seed.

 

Explante Biotecnologia, which has been in the market for more than 20 years, has been developing processes and technologies for producing in vitro seedlings on a large scale, with the aim of meeting the growing demand from producers and companies that need to expand high-potential genetic materials. Explante has been evolving its seedling production processes with modern meristem extraction and plant multiplication techniques, using improved bioreactors for different crops.
